Output 8320c2181fa11870d5a437fa4a2ecee366e5c2bc8a7786bdc701710eec57520c:0

value
23192
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6aa0010a900ff3a3c74683a1a11574841c9e1a3 OP_EQUAL
address
3JLrZHHehBS4Hve79xV7K9hcRhtrzWbyTH
transaction
8320c2181fa11870d5a437fa4a2ecee366e5c2bc8a7786bdc701710eec57520c
confirmations
9884
spent
true